Southwest Wisconsin Technical College tops our 2026 ranking of the best-value Agricultural Mechanization certificate degree schools in the United States. This public school is set in Fennimore, WI. Students from in state pay about $4,904 in tuition and fees, compared with $7,147 for out-of-state students. Students borrow a median of $12,112 to complete their Agricultural Mechanization program here. Southwest Wisconsin Technical College alumni report median earnings of $43,470 a decade after entry. Set against $12,112 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. Read more about Southwest Wisconsin Technical College
A rank of #2 makes Ivy Tech Community College one of the best values in the United States. Set in Indianapolis, IN, Ivy Tech Community College is a public institution.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$5,154, while out-of-state students pay about $9,935. The median Agricultural Mechanization program debt is $11,889. Ivy Tech Community College alumni report median earnings of $37,186 a decade after entry.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value. See the full Ivy Tech Community College profile
Out of the 90 schools in the United States in this year's value ranking, University Of Missouri Columbia landed the #3 spot. Set in Columbia, MO, University Of Missouri Columbia is a public institution. Expect in-state tuition and fees of around $14,837, compared with $36,056 for out-of-state students. Students borrow a median of $18,479 to complete their Agricultural Mechanization program here. A decade after starting, students earn a median of $63,403.
